New Delhi. According to the big news coming from the economic sector, now Gold has made a new record today i.e. Wednesday, i.e. on 5th April. Yes, the price of 10 grams of gold has increased to Rs 61 thousand today. This is currently the all-time high.

In fact, according to the website of the India Bullion and Jewelers Association (IBJA), gold has become costlier by Rs 1,262 to reach Rs 60.977 in the bullion market today. On the other hand, earlier on March 31, gold had made its all-time high, when it had reached Rs 59.751/10 grams.

Along with this, today silver has also crossed 74 thousand. On the other hand, according to the website of IBJA, today silver has become costlier by Rs 2.822 and has reached Rs 74.522 in the bullion market. This is also its high level in the last 31 months.

65 thousand can be gold

At the same time, according to market experts, the super cycle started in gold in 2020 is still going on. Gold was estimated to reach 62,000 this year, but in the present circumstances it can now reach 64,000 very comfortably. On the other hand, according to market estimates, gold is getting support due to the ups and downs seen in the stock market. Due to this, by the end of this year, gold can go up to 65 thousand rupees / 10 grams.
